Summary

Authorizing the Department of Transportation to acquire the Garcon Point Bridge and related assets and purchase or retire specified outstanding bonds; requiring that the bridge be owned by the department and become part of the State Highway System upon acquisition, if acquired under specified provisions; authorizing the issuance of bonds to finance the department's acquisition of the bridge consistent with the department's existing bonding authority; repealing part IV of ch. 348, F.S., relating to the Santa Rosa Bay Bridge Authority, upon the department's acquisition of the bridge under specified provisions, etc.
